(""); } return std::string(arr_tmp); } int main(int argc, char* argv[], char *env[]) { /// 读取executable所在绝对路径 std::string exec_str = get_cur_executable_path_(); std::cout << "str=" << exec_str << "\n\n"; /// 用于获取磁盘剩余空间 struct statfs diskInfo; ...
if(-1==(flag=statfs(dpath,diskInfo)))//获取包含磁盘空间信息的结构体 { perror("getDiskInfo statfs fail"); return 0; } return 1; } //计算磁盘总空间,非超级用户可用空间,磁盘所有剩余空间,计算结果以字符串的形式存储到三个字符串里面,单位为MB int calDiskInfo(char *diskTotal,char *diskAvail,...
1. df命令:df命令用于显示文件系统的磁盘空间利用情况。可以使用以下命令来查看剩余空间: “` df -h “` 这会以人类可读的方式显示文件系统的磁盘空间使用情况,包括已用空间、可用空间和挂载点。 2. du命令:du命令用于估算文件或目录的磁盘空间使用情况。可以使用以下命令来查看当前目录的磁盘空间使用情况: “` d...
51CTO博客已为您找到关于linux c 获取磁盘大小的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及linux c 获取磁盘大小问答内容。更多linux c 获取磁盘大小相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
java linux 磁盘空间 获取 linux获取磁盘剩余空间,一、df命令; df是来自于coreutils软件包,系统安装时,就自带的;我们通过这个命令可以查看磁盘的使用情况以及文件系统被挂载的位置; 举例: [root@XXX~]#df-lhFilesystem Size&n
-c, --total 显示总计信息 -D, --dereference-args 解除命令行中列出的符号连接 --files0-from=F 计算文件F 中以NUL 结尾的文件名对应占用的磁盘空间 如果F 的值是"-",则从标准输入读入文件名 -H 等于--dereference-args (-D) -h, --human-readable 以可读性较好的方式显示尺寸(例如:1K 234M 2G) ...
查看Linux 系统上挂载的驱动器的空间使用情况非常简单。只要你将你的驱动器挂载在 Linux 系统上,使用 df 命令或 du 命令在报告必要信息方面都会非常出色。使用 df 命令,您可以快速查看磁盘上总的空间使用量,使用 du 命令,可以查看特定目录的空间使用情况。对于每一个 Linux 系统的管理员来说,这两个命令的结合使用...
原文链接:https://www.runoob.com/w3cnote/linux-view-disk-space.html Linux 查看磁盘空间可以使用...df df 以磁盘分区为单位查看文件系统,可以获取硬盘被占用了多少空间,目前还剩下多少空间等信息。例如,我们使用df -h命令来查看磁盘信息, -h 选...
原文链接:https://www.runoob.com/w3cnote/linux-view-disk-space.html Linux 查看磁盘空间可以使用...Filesystem:文件系统 Size: 分区大小 Used: 已使用容量 Avail: 还可以使用的容量 Use%: 已用百分比 Mounted on...